柯林斯词典
- PHRASAL VERB 消耗;耗费
If someoneburns offenergy, they use it.- This will improve your performance and help you burn off calories.
这将会改善你的表现,并帮你消耗卡路里。

- PHRASAL VERB 烧掉;烧除
Toburn offsomething unwanted means to get rid of it by burning it.- The bushfire actually helped to burn off a lot of dead undergrowth.
林区大火实际上有助于清除很多枯死的矮灌木。
